Meaning of 'பறை ' in திருப்பாவை

"பறை " is the oft-repeated word in Thiruppavai. Its meaning is not just a drum.
The taathparyam of it can be known from the upadesa of Acharyas and
discourses by elders and scholars.

பறை



This post looks into its implied meaning from the point of view of Tamil lexicon.
From ancient texts it is learnt that 'arai-parai' is used in specific contexts only.
Arai means 'பாறை ' or rock or boulder.
Arai parai is beating the rock.
When a rock is beaten (with an axe) it creates a tremendous sound / noise.
Since it is not easy to beat (or break) the rock, the beating is continuously done.
And the beating can not be done secretively – the sound reverberates everywhere.
It is for this reason, when something that is not known or revealed already,
is needed to be made known to all, 'அறை -பறை will be done.


When the Cheran king, செங்குட்டுவன் decided to go to the Himalayas
to get a rock for making Kannagi's image,
he wanted his trip to the North to be made known to all the kings on the way.
He said that the spies of those kings were anyway roaming in the streets of his kingdom
to gather information on his moves so that they could secretly convey it
to their respective kings.
'Now let this trip be known to all without any doubt –
that I am going to the Himalayas with an army and if anyone comes in my way,
I will teach them a lesson. Announce it as 'arai parai', said the king.
(Silappadhikaram, chapter 25, 177 – "அறை -பறை என்றே அழும்பில் வேளுரைப்ப")


In குறள் 1076, Thiruvalluvar tells "அறை பறை அன்ன கயவர் ".
Arai parai in this verse is explained by the commentator, ParimElazhagar
as announcing aloud to everyone something which is originally guarded as a secret.


Applying this meaning to AndaaL's arai parai, we get some interesting leads.
This word is used by AndaaL at the time of knocking the doors of Krishna's abode.
The door is closed, prompting AndaaL to ask the door keeper to open it.
Why should the door keeper take the words of the aayar girls seriously
and open the door for them?

According to AndaaL he has to open it because
மாயன் மணிவண்ணன் has said it long ago with the 'அறை -பறை '
'அறை பறை மாயன் மணிவண்ணன் நென்னலே வாய் நேர்ந்தான்'.
மாயன் 'முன்பே வாய் விட்டுவிட்டான் ' –
Maayan has given word long ago in strong terms as arai-parai.
So there was something kept as a secret,
which Mayan Manivannan had announced by means of arai-parai long ago.
Having got that information,
AndaaL and her friends have come to his door step.
What could have been the secret that Maayan had announced aloud already?
What else it can be but the மாயன் உரை , (நான் முகன் திரு .. 50)
known as a secret until then,
and announced for the mankind in the battlefield at the Dharma kshethram!
The Mayan urai is nothing but the Charama slokam of Mayan, the Gitacharyan.
asking us to renounce even the fruits of our action and
surrender unto His feet.
